I don’t have that money – Spice Diana clarifies delays in releasing Diamond Platnumz collabo

Spice Diana claims she is yet to raise the amount of money needed for her collaborations with Diamond Platnumz to be finalised and released.

In 2021, Spice Diana got closer to Diamond Platnumz’s Wasafi record label, later working with Zuchu on their collabo dubbed “Upendo”.

She has since made a couple of visits to Tanzania and last year she revealed that they worked on a couple of collaborations with Diamond.

But none is yet to be released yet her fans and critics continue to pin her to release the music.

Spice Diana and Diamond Platnumz

During an interview, Spice Diana revealed that she is yet to raise the money required by Diamond to shoot visuals for their first collaboration.

We have more than one song, we have many songs but sometimes it’s the money. To have a video that matches his standards (is expensive).

He just made a video with Jason (Derulo) and the amount of money he invested in it, we don’t even earn it here.

When he performs in Uganda he is given at least USD100,000. I have never been paid that much here in Uganda. So to make a video with him, it has to at least be worth USD50,000.

Spice Diana also hinted that at times such artists will be open to easing their rates for such collaborations but ask for sex in return which she isn’t willing to give.
